How do I fill out a PDF (form) document online?

I have downloaded a PDF to fill out, some of the PDF's are greyed out in the spaces that need to be filled out, other forms don't have the greyed out bit, is there some way I can get it to grey out so I can fill it out online without having to print it and do it with ink?

If the fields are greyed out then that is how the author of the form intended it to be. It may be a form that can only be filled in by printing and using ink.
If the author intended it to be interactive then you would be able to type in this fields.

  • HT2506 Font size filling out a PDF form in Preview?

    Hello. Anyone know if I can change Font size when filling out a PDF form in Preview? If so, how? Thanks a lot.

    Whilst in the Preview application, press "Shift - Command - A" (⇧⌘A) simultaneously to show the markup toolbar, or click View, and select "show markup toolbar". There is an icon "A" near the right hand side of the now visible markup toolbar, click this icon to reveal all the font options.

  • When filling out a PDF form and reopening it is blank

    When I fill out a form using Acrobat XI pro and then save it with the same name or a different name and try to reopen it, it is blank.  I can us the quick print feature and it will actually print out the information I thought I saved.  But if I open it again it shows blank.  Any ideas?

    RebeccaFlameLily,
    This problem occurs when the Preview application on a Mac is used to fill-in the forms. It is well known the Preview corrupts PDFs in a number of ways and it should be absolutely avoided when using PDF forms. The damage it does to a document cannot be repaired, but you can open the corrupted form in Acrobat, export the form data (to an FDF or XFDF file), and import it back into a blank form. Then inform your users to use Adobe Reader and not Preview.

  • Open pdf says "please fill out the following form" when I attempt to apply redactions, I get an error message.  How do I "turn off" the form portion of the document?  I assume that is the problem since I have not had this issue with any of the other files

    I am attempting to redact a large pdf file.  When I open the file, it has a bar across the top with the message "please fill out the following form".  I can mark redactions, but when I attempt to apply them I get a message saying, "In order to proceed Digital Signatures must be removed and the document must be fully authorized.  Do you want to make these changes and continue?"   I click "ok".  Then I get a message saying, "an internal error occurred."  How do I get around this problem?

    You cannot redact a signed document. This is because one of the things signatures guarantee is access to the OLDER document (i.e. there will be an unredacted copy in there).
    In general you cannot remove signatures, but sometimes you can. Look under the Signatures tab (right click on left vertical bar if there isn't one) to see if it is removable.
